Ensuring Proper Fit for Welding
Pipe beveling machines shape the pipe ends. This helps the pipes fit tightly. A good fit makes the weld stronger. Loose pipes can cause weak welds.
That may lead to leaks or breaks. The machine helps avoid that. It makes the job smooth. There are fewer gaps to fill. The welder can work faster with a better fit.
Improving Weld Quality
Good welds need good pipe edges. The machine makes smooth bevels for this. Welds hold better with clean edges. This stops cracks or holes in the weld.
The machine helps keep the weld strong. It makes the job more reliable. Smooth edges help the filler flow better. It also helps heat spread evenly. The final weld looks better and lasts longer.
